This file was contributed for use in the USGenWeb Archives by: Mark Murphy murphy@tiaer.tarleton.edu ==================================================================== [Extract of Court records, Maury Co. 1822] [microfilm roll 179, p. 143, book C, Court of Pleas and Sessions] [transcribed by Mark A. Murphy, 9/12/2000] 143 Monday, October 21st 1822 6 Jury of View Jas Baldridge, Lothers[?]-Rescended Ordered that James Baldridge, Alexander Baldridge, Michael Steele, Thad M. Stone, Edward Puckett Senr, William D. Steele, Richard Fausceth or any five of them be appointed as Jury of View to view, mark and lay out a road to begin on the Shelbyville road near Loves Mill to run the best way in a direction up Silver Creek to come into the sd Shelbyville some where near Leepers Mill ed. Bedford County to go in such a direction as far as the Maury County line and make report to our ensuing County Court. 7 A. Hamon Lothers[?] Jury of View return We the within appointed Jurors being summoned & agreeable to the arther[?] order commenced the duty aSsigned us at the end of the Straight leading from the mouth of Solomon Herring's Lane following marked trees croSsing fence branch just above the form belonging to the heirs of Major Saunders Deceased thence one line of marked trees to the corners of said Sanders[sic] & Colo. James T. Sandford thence on a line marked so as to Intersect the line of the Jug Tavern tract at a part where Ar[?] Chairs fence will stacke the same thence with sd line paSsing the plantation of said Chairs then leaving sd line turning eastwardly untill intersecting the line between Nathl Chairs and Abram Hamon running through the corner of Hamon east into sd Hamons lane thence into the Davis's ford road at sd Hamons house, October 15th 1822. James T. Sandford, Nathl Chairs X Abraham Hamon, Solomon Herring, Thomas Smith, Jacob Rodgers, William W. Hamon, James Huey. 8 Wm. W. Hamon Aversion If@ Ordered that William W. Hamon be appointed aversion of the publick road from the creek to the mouth of Abram Hamon lane and that the following hands vis Jacob Rogers, Ezekiel Akin, Isaac Ford, John Dobbins, Borevell[?] Akins, Joseph Rhoads, Andrew Mills, William Caldwell, William Allen, Newton Rhoads, Abram Rhoads, John Hilorease[?], James Huey, Wiley Seall, James Mills, Edward Robertson, John Baugus, David Underwood, Hampton N. Turner, Thomas Young, Solomon Bunch, William Rogers, Widore Mcaens[?], Thomas Smith, Solomon Herring, Wm. Langford, William Land, Wm. Loves, Green Hill, James P. Sandford Sr, Dodson Perkins, hands at the Jugg Tavern, Wm. Hamon, Murphy Adle, Wm. Biggs to aSsent in opening the road and after the new road is opened all the hands on the South of Rother fords creek to work under Burwell Akin and all on the North Side of the creek to continue to work under Wm. W. Hamons and it shall be the duty of Hamon to notify Burwell Akins when he will commence opening said road and Akins shall warn his hands and work with them under the direction of Hamons till the road is opened. 9 Agreeable to an order of Court to us directed at July Yarm[?] 1822 we the undersigned do hereby certify that we have met accordingly.
